In addition to our usual broad range of local foods at the market this week, we welcome back Team Tea. Salt Pig will be with us selling cured meats and salamis. Make. Do. Mend. are back with sewing alterations, repairs & commissions, and we welcome Crust Bakes to their first market, selling vegan sweets and savouries and joining our regular mix of takeaways.

Broken Spoke Bike Coop are running a drop-in "DIY" Bike Workshop where you can learn to fix your bike every Thursday and Friday from 11am to 5pm at St Thomas School, Osney Lane, Oxford, OX1 1NJ

Looking for something interesting to do on a Sunday? OxGrow meet every Sunday afternoon to garden together, share a cup of tea & cake, & learn about growing. 12-4pm, Hog Acre Common Garden, Oxford.
